NSC-370284 is a selective inhibitor of ten-eleven translocation 1 ( TET1 ) and 5-hydroxymethylcytosine ( 5hmC ). NSC-370284 significantly inhibits the level of TET1 expression via targets STAT3/5In VitroNSC-370284 (0-500 nM; 24 h or 48 h) inhibits the viability of MONOMAC-6, THP-1, KOCL-48 and KASUMI-1 acute myeloid leukemia (AML) cells via targeting STAT3/5. NSC-370284 significantly down-regulates the level of TET1 transcription. MCE has not independently confirmed the accuracy of these methods. They are for reference only. Cell Viability AssayCell Line: AML cell lines including MONOMAC-6, THP-1, KOCL-48, and KASUMI-1. Concentration: 0, 25, 50, 200 or 500 nM. Incubation Time: 24 h or 48 h. Result: Showed inhibitory for AML cells viability and TET1 transcription.In VivoNSC-370284 (2.5 mg/kg; i.p., once daily for 10 days) improves the pathological morphologies in peripheral blood (PB), bone marrow (BM), spleen, and liver tissues in MLL-AF9 acute myeloid leukemia (AML) mice model . MCE has not independently confirmed the accuracy of these methods. They are for reference only. Animal Model: C57BL/6 (CD45.2) and B6.SJL (CD45.1) mice . Dosage: 2.5 mg/kg. Administration: Intraperitoneal injection, once daily, for 10 days. Result: Significantly inhibited MLL-AF9 induced AML in secondary bone marrow transplantation (BMT) recipient mice.Form:SolidIC50& Target:STAT3 STAT5 TET1.
